The Ca Mau Peninsula is one of the areas with severe and frequent subsidence. The warning system is built based on the factor weighting method combined with GIS technology. This subsidence warning system due to drought and groundwater exploitation was applied for the dry season in 2024. Results show that subsidence locations from the system are relatively consistent with surveyed subsidence locations. The subsidence warning system will be an effective tool and will be transferred to the Ca Mau provincial hydrometeorological station for use in their work in the dry season in 2025. This system can be replicated in areas facing increasing subsidence. %K Subsidence Warning System %K Drought %K Groundwater Exploitation %K Ca Mau Peninsula %K Vietnam %U http://www.scirp.org/journal/PaperInformation.aspx?PaperID=135944
